We offer three degrees in the Department of Chemistry and Biochemistry: Chemistry, Biochemistry (mandatory Biology minor) and a Teacher certification degree in Physical Science (Physics minor).

The specific requirements for each of these degrees along with course descriptions may be found in the 2003-2005 catalog.
